Output df7095529fbaeba15099b2043df565515255a97ca7935c2abbcd618f14e18a59:0

value
359600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86489817c03a468fc1961833704a71c5e6abfe5d OP_EQUAL
address
3Dw3SBBcjWHmUjzVDrkM9hD2xpkE7gwCKc
transaction
df7095529fbaeba15099b2043df565515255a97ca7935c2abbcd618f14e18a59
spent
true